Finding budget tools can be an adventure in itself. Here are numerous locations where one can scour for inexpensive yet quality tools:
1. Regional Hardware Stores
Numerous regional hardware stores typically have a clearance section where old stock is cost lowered rates. It's worth examining in regularly, as you may find remarkably bargains.
2. Online Retailers
A number of Online Tool Store platforms use competitive pricing on tools. Here's a peek at some of the best:
WebsiteSpecializedAmazonLarge range of tools and client reviewsScrewfixSpecializes in structure and upkeep tools; excellent offersToolstationCost effective costs on a huge choice of toolsB&Q Occasional sales and promos 3. Discount rate Chains Shops likeAldi and Lidl periodically
stock tools as part of unique promos. These can offer outstanding quality at decreased costs. 4. Second-Hand Markets Platforms such as eBay, Gumtree
, and Facebook Marketplace are best for picking up pre-owned tools at a fraction of the initial price. Always check the condition and evaluates if available. 5. Tool Rental Services If a tool is required for simply a one-off task, renting can be an economical service. Companies like HSS Hire offer a vast array of tools at flexible rental rates. 6. Buying in Bulk Sometimes, buying a set of tools rather than individual pieces cansave money. Search for mix packs that come with discount rates.
